Job Description:

Are you a committed Qualified Social Worker? Do you have a passion for providing first-class support to Children's Services? We have a fantastic Locum Social Work Opportunity based within a Duty and Assessment Team in the Rochdale area. You will be working alongside a team of dedicated professionals who are committed to providing an effective, child-centred service to children in need of support and protection.

Job Responsibility:

  • Responding to new referrals from professionals and members of the public
  • Signposting people to other agencies or completing an assessment of need, investigating allegations so that children/young people are protected from harm
  • Managing a varied and complex caseload
  • Undertaking Court Work
  • Writing concise, fit-for-purpose reports/court statements
  • Working well within a team and with external agencies

Requirements:

  • Experience of working in a 'Children's Duty and Assessment' team (desirable)
  • SWE registration
  • BSc Social Work or equivalent
